Reignite Your Energy: Hormonal Wellness During Menopause
Menopause is a significant transition in a woman's life, often accompanied by varying hormone levels. These changes can display in various ways, such as exhaustion, mood swings, and sleep disturbances. Understanding these hormonal shifts is essential to navigating menopause comfortably.
Implementing lifestyle strategies can significantly influence your well-being during this time. Prioritize daily exercise, as it boosts energy levels and optimizes mood.
A bal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ains provides your body with the necessary nutrients it demands.
Enough sleep is critical for hormone regulation and overall well-being.
Investigating alternative therapies such as acupuncture or yoga may also reveal beneficial. Talking to a healthcare professional can provide specific advice and support throughout your menopause journey.
